An oversized HVAC system reaches the thermostat setpoint quickly without adequately conditioning the rest of the home or removing adequate humidity from the circulated air in Flowery Branch, GA. In cooling mode, the short cycles an oversized system produces do not run long enough to dehumidify effectively in Flowery Branch. Indoor humidity remains elevated despite the air conditioner running in Flowery Branch, GA. The home feels cold and clammy rather than cool and comfortable in Flowery Branch. And the frequent startup and shutdown cycles accumulate wear on the compressor that shortens the system's service life in Flowery Branch, GA.
An undersized HVAC system runs continuously in extreme weather without reaching the thermostat setpoint in Flowery Branch. The home is consistently warmer in summer and cooler in winter than the thermostat calls for during the most demanding weather in Flowery Branch, GA. The system runs at maximum capacity for extended periods, consuming maximum energy while delivering inadequate comfort in Flowery Branch.
MBM performs a Manual J load calculation for every HVAC installation in Flowery Branch. The calculation accounts for floor area, ceiling height, insulation R-values in all building assemblies, window area, orientation and SHGC, local design temperatures, and internal heat gains in Flowery Branch, GA. The output is the correct system capacity for the specific home in Flowery Branch. Not an estimate based on square footage alone in Flowery Branch, GA.
Manual J determines the correct system capacity. Manual D designs the duct system. Manual J determines the correct system capacity in Flowery Branch, GA. Manual D designs the duct system to correctly distribute the conditioned air that capacity produces to each room in Flowery Branch. A correctly sized system installed on an incorrectly designed duct system cannot deliver the right amount of conditioned air to each room regardless of its overall capacity in Flowery Branch, GA. Both calculations are required for a complete installation that performs correctly at the room level in Flowery Branch. A repair that costs more than 50 percent of the cost of a new system on a system that is more than 10 years old warrants serious consideration of replacement in Flowery Branch, GA. A second significant repair within a few seasons on an aging system suggests the system is entering the period of accelerating component failure in Flowery Branch.
A system that is 15 years old or more is in the final years of its designed service life regardless of whether it is currently operating in Flowery Branch. Pre-emptive replacement allows the homeowner to select the system, timing, and budget rather than making those decisions under the pressure of a failed system in the middle of summer or winter in Flowery Branch, GA.
Replacing a 10 SEER system with an 18 SEER system reduces cooling energy consumption by approximately 44 percent for the same cooling output in Flowery Branch, GA. Over a 15-year service life, those savings accumulate to a total that contributes substantially to the payback on the replacement investment in Flowery Branch.
